How to Identify Your Shark Vacuum's Model Year

To determine the model year of a Shark vacuum, check the original packaging, sales receipt, or the serial/date code on the vacuum's data plate. Model year labels on the box or product name often align with fiscal launch windows rather than exact calendar years. For ambiguous cases, cross-reference the motor type, filtration system, and brushroll configuration with known generational traits. If you are unsure, contact Shark support with the serial number to obtain the most accurate production and warranty timing.

Compatibility and Parts Across Model Years

Many Shark vacuum parts remain compatible across close model year groupings, but revisions in bin shape, brushroll ends, or battery contacts can occur. When searching for filters, belts, or roller assemblies, confirm the exact model code rather than relying solely on an approximate year. Firmware or electronic components on robotic and sensor-equipped models may be strictly tied to specific model year ranges and regional variants.
